    Default Patton Said.....

    From
    The Unknown Patton
    Charles M. Province
    ISBN 0-517-455951

    Page 16:
    *** News Item ***
    Man At Work
    New York, July 15 (UP)

    In Sicily, Messerschmitts circled a nearby hill, but Technical Sergeant Richard Redding, stringing wire atop a telephone pole and a perfect target, worked on. Someone yelled up from below, “What are you doing up that pole?”
    “Working,” said Redding , too engrossed to glance down.
    “How long you been up there?”
    “About 20 minutes.”
    “Don’t the planes bother you?”
    “Hell, no – but you do!”
    At the foot of the pole, Lieutenant General George S. Patton, Jr. who had been doing the yelling, kept his piece.
